CPC minister calls on President Faure |14 July 2018

 

 

 

Song Tao, the Minister for the International Department of the Central Committee of the Communist Party of China (CPC) yesterday paid a courtesy call on President Danny Faure at State House.

Other than his ministerial delegation, Mr Song was accompanied at yesterday’s visit by the Chinese ambassador to Seychelles Yu Jinsong.

Other than exchanging views on the party-to-party relations, other issues discussed yesterday were the promotion of the friendly relations between the two countries and also the commitment to expand cooperation in various areas.

Mr Song said, as a friend to Seychelles, China is sincerely happy about the economic growth that the country has achieved, as well as the improvement in the living condition of its people.

He added that the good tradition of friendship between the two countries is in line with the fundamental interests of the two sides.

“It is important to step up exchanges and extend the tradition of friendship, as much as the pragmatic cooperation in a number of areas, so as to boost the growth of the state-to-state relations, in order to benefit the people of both countries,” he added.

During his stay, Mr Song and his delegation met and discussed with members of the Parti Lepep Central Committee and Executive Committee members from both Mahé and the inner islands.

Mr Song and his delegation comprising deputy director general Wang Heming, directors Liang Anping and Zheng Junlu, first secretary Qi Wei and second secretary Dong Zhenyu leave the country today.
